This item is already soldBoxed Unbuilt Dracula's Dragster Monster Model Kit Car
Dracula   Vampire   Dragster   Monster   Model Kit   Car   Toy
The picture shows a view of the box cover of this unbuilt Dracula's Dragster Monster Model Kit Car. The original odd rods were are some of the most sought after classic models kits around today. This is a 1/10 scale re-issue kit by Polar Lights. Model #5026. It is licensed by Universal Studios and ©1999.

This kit has all of the parts but they are off the sprues. None of the parts are painted or glued. The instructions are not here, but it is an easy model to complete without them. The colorful box measures 13-1/8'' x 5-1/4'' x 2-1/8''. The parts are in mint condition and the box is excellent.
